New Code Vein II Trailer Reveals It’s Coming In January

by admin September 26, 2025


We’re only a handful of months removed from Code Vein II’s announcement during Summer Game Fest, but we already know when fans of the original can get their hands on it. Those looking to ring in the new year with style will be happy to know the upcoming Soulslike action game is coming on January 30.

A new trailer was revealed during today’s PlayStation State of Play, showing off protagonist Tokugawa Takechiyo, forced from the shogunate throne, who confronts his rebellious brother Tokugawa Kunimatsu in battle. The time-traveling adventure takes players across multiple eras to hunt monsters called Horrors, where players can change the fates of key characters as they slice and dice enemies using the game’s unique blood-draining combat system. You can also join forces with various allies who lend unique abilities to the fight. 

 

Code Vein II will be available on P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C on January 30.

Solana Jumps Above $240, Hitting Highest Price Since January

by admin September 12, 2025



In brief

  • Solana surged 5.5% and hit $241, reaching its highest level since late January amid growing institutional interest.
  • Forward Industries secured a $1.65 billion PIPE deal led by Galaxy Digital, Jump Crypto, and Multicoin Capital, boosting SOL momentum.
  • BIT Mining adds 17,221 SOL to treasury as prediction market traders grow 89% confident SOL will hit $250 before $130.

Solana surged 5.5% on Friday and hit a daily peak above $241—the highest price seen since late January, as SOL gets a bullish boost from institutional interest.

Forward Industries, a Nasdaq-traded design firm that serves medical and technology companies, announced earlier this week it had inked a $1.65 billion private investment in private equity, or PIPE, deal led by crypto financial services company Galaxy Digital, infrastructure firm Jump Crypto, and venture capital firm Multicoin Capital.

The company, which trades on the NasdaqCM exchange under the FORD ticker, saw its price briefly touch $46 on Friday. But at the time of writing, it’s fallen back to $37.72. Despite the retrace, it’s still trading 9.41% higher than yesterday.



Solana climbed above $215 when the PIPE deal was announced at the start of the week, but it’s reached even higher highs in the 24 hours since the deal closed. As of this writing, Solana is still 18% shy of the $293.31 all-time high that it set in January, according to crypto price aggregator CoinGecko.

With the latest price move, users on Myriad, a prediction market owned by Decrypt parent company DASTAN, have become increasingly certain that SOL will keep climbing. In the past week, users who think Solana will rise to $250 sooner than it can drop to $130 have increased from 66% to 89%, as of this writing.

The token’s price has also been boosted by the news that BIT Mining, which plans to change its New York Stock Exchange ticker to SOLAI, has added 17,221 SOL to its treasury. In July, the company saw its shares, which currently trade under the BTBT ticker, soar to more than $5 per share after the Akron, Ohio firm said it would begin building a Solana treasury.

At the time of writing, BTBT is trading for approximately $3 per share after having gained 1.9% on the day.

Amazon’s Tomb Raider adaptation to begin production in January 2026, Sophie Turner to star as Lara Croft

by admin September 5, 2025


Production on Amazon’s Tomb Raider series will begin on January 19, 2026, with Sophie Turner confirmed to star as Lara Croft.

As Variety reports, the adaptation is helmed by Phoebe Waller-Bridge alongside Wayward Pines creator Chad Hodge. Waller-Bridge will also serve as creator, writer, and executive producer.

Shōgun director Jonathan van Tulleken is also attached to direct the series, as well as executive produce.

“I’m so excited to announce the formidable Sophie Turner as our Lara alongside this phenomenal creative team,” said Waller-Bridge.

“It’s not very often you get to make a show of this scale with a character you grew up loving. Everyone on board is wildly passionate about Lara and are all as outrageous, brave, and hilarious as she is.”

Turner added: “I’m thrilled beyond measure to be playing Lara Croft. She’s such an iconic character, who means so much to many – and I’m giving everything I’ve got.

“They’re massive shoes to fill, following in the steps of Angelina [Jolie] and Alicia [Vikander] with their powerhouse performances, but with Phoebe at the helm, we (and Lara) are all in very safe hands.”

Amazon MGM Studios greenlit Waller-Bridge’s Tomb Raider series in May 2024. Crystal Dynamics will serve as a producer and executive producer, alongside Story Kitchen and Waller-Bridge’s Wells Street Productions.
